What is The Family Connection?
The Family Connection is a resource to help busy principals and assistant principals with their communications to parents and families. We offer this as a free service to AMLE members. Feel free to browse the latest issue or back issues to find an article or whole issue on a topic that you're looking for. You can use the publication "as is", or cut and paste articles as you see fit. Not a member? Take a look at this free sample issue to see what you're missing.
